    Abstract: An error correction method and device for a line structured light 3D camera. The method comprises: placing a 3D calibration plate at different positions in the field of view of the 3D camera, and allowing a relative motion to scan the 3D calibration plate to obtain multiple sets of point cloud data at different positions; processing the point cloud data and calculating corner coordinates of the 3D calibration plate corresponding to each set of point cloud data; constructing an error correction model by using an inclination angle, caused by an error, between a straight line along which the relative motion direction lies and a laser plane of the 3D camera as an error model correction parameter; calculating error correction model parameters according to a space vector constraint relationship between corner points; and applying the model to the point cloud data of a measured object to obtain distortion-free point cloud data.

    Abstract: A method for enriching carbon dioxide and hydrogen by water-gas shift coupling of blast furnace gas is disclosed in the present application, belonging to the technical field of flue gas resource utilization, where the method includes: purifying the blast furnace gas by a dry purification method, followed by heating and mixing with water vapor, allowing for water vapor shift coupling reaction under an action of a catalyst to obtain a mixed gas of carbon dioxide and hydrogen; adsorbing the mixed gas of carbon dioxide and hydrogen with a carbon dioxide adsorbent and desorbing to obtain carbon dioxide; introducing a gas not adsorbed by the carbon dioxide adsorbent into a molecular sieve adsorbent to remove impurities, then obtaining a hydrogen. Blast furnace gas is used as raw material, and hydrogen is provided for subsequent hydrogen smelting while realizing carbon enrichment in the blast furnace process.

    Abstract: An electronic device may display, by using a viewfinder picture in an augmented reality (AR) application interface, an object that is in the real world in which a user is located and that is collected by a camera. The user may enable, by performing an operation, the AR application to generate a mask in an area in which a first object is located in the viewfinder picture to block the first object. Then, a three-dimensional representation of a second object is projected onto the mask, where the second object is in a field of view range of the area in which the first object is located.

    Abstract: A web page clustering method and device, used for clustering web pages according to a web page framework, the method including: acquiring uniform resource locators (URL) of a plurality of web pages to be clustered; for the URL of each web page to be clustered, determining rewriting rules of the URL and classifying the URL according to the rewriting rules of the URL; determining a web page framework of the web page corresponding to each URL in each URL class, and determining whether each URL may be clustered according to the web page framework of the web page corresponding to each URL; and retaining the URL class if each URL may be clustered.
